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Coventry to Bodmin is to bus which costs £35 - £60 and takes 9h 40m.
The fastest way to get from Coventry to Bodmin is to drive which takes 4h 3m and costs £50 - £80.
No, there is no direct bus from Coventry station to Bodmin. However, there are services departing from Pool Meadow Bus Station and arriving at Dennison Road Car Park via Heathrow Central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 8h 50m.
The distance between Coventry and Bodmin is 267 miles. The road distance is 221 miles.
The best way to get from Coventry to Bodmin without a car is to train which takes 6h 27m and costs £75 - £220.
It takes approximately 6h 27m to get from Coventry to Bodmin, including transfers.
Coventry to Bodmin bus services, operated by National Express, depart from Pool Meadow Bus Station.
The best way to get from Coventry to Bodmin is to train which takes 6h 27m and costs £75 - £220. Alternatively, you can bus via London Heathrow Airport (LHR), which costs £55 - £95 and takes 8h 50m, you could also fly, which costs £65 - £270 and takes 7h 15m.
Coventry to Bodmin bus services, operated by National Express, arrive at Heathrow Central Bus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Coventry to Bodmin is 221 miles. It takes approximately 4h 3m to drive from Coventry to Bodmin.
